Default mufflers?????

I hate the sound of my turbo with no cats or mufflers. I was thinking of putting a 2 magnaflow 6" before the turbo. I have dueled 2 1/2 exhaust. I want to here more wistle and less popping and resanence. Any good ideas that have been tried? Here is a pic of my exhaust, thanks for any help.

i had 3.5" exhaust with 2 bullets inline and my truck was prety quiet. i probably had about 8' of exhaust after the turbo though.

i like your idea of two small strait thru magnaflows before the turbo. i bet that would quiet it down a lot without slowing the spool time too much. one of those mufflers has to be less restrictive than a cat doesn't it?

I was in the same boat a couple of months ago, and this is what I ended up with. Quite most of the time and can be uncapped when I got to the strip. Didn't loose any of the whistle with it being after the turbo, but my new MP T-70 hardly has any whistle. I think it because it a lot bigger compressor and isn't turning as fast.
